Australian firm eyes Abenab drilling

Cazaly Resources has secured ground access to the Cadix anomaly at its Abenab North project in northern Namibia, clearing the final hurdle before advancing exploration activities at what it considers its highest-priority target.

Managing director Tara French says fieldwork, including geophysical surveys and drill planning, is scheduled to begin in the third quarter of this year.

The company plans to undertake baseline geological mapping, detailed magnetic surveys and finalise drill programme designs ahead of the commencement of field activities later this year.
